WebAcute cardiac failure, pulmonary edema, and ischemia of the brain, cord, and other structures pose special problems with trauma to the aortic arch and its branches. Data on 93 such cases are reported. Diagnosis was made by clinical examination in hemodynamically unstable patients and led to immediate operation in 61.3%. The right ventricle is the part of the heart that pumps blood without oxygen to the lungs. … WebSep 19, 2024 · Dextrocardia is a congenital cardiac malposition in which the heart is situated on the right side of the body ( dextroversion) with the cardiac apex pointing to the right. Terminology Dextrocardia merely refers to the laterality of the heart, it says nothing about the orientation of the patient's other organs.

WebJul 18, 2024 · The draped aorta sign is an important imaging feature that can be seen in contained rupture of an abdominal aortic aneurysm.
